Treasury strategy is governance strategy in slow motion. The asset mix matters, but the first-order question is who can move funds, who can change the signer set, who can widen a whitelist, and who can rewrite the rules after the market moves against the project. Safe smart accounts let owners and thresholds be modified, and OpenZeppelin timelocks are explicitly designed to delay privileged actions, which is why any serious treasury plan has to start at the permission layer rather than at the portfolio layer.

That framing is uncomfortable for teams that prefer to describe the treasury as “community owned.” In practice, most token-based projects route control through some combination of token voters, a multisig, a foundation, and one or more external managers. Arbitrum’s 2025 treasury consolidation proposal said the DAO’s treasury management had become fragmented across multiple committees, then proposed a new three-part council with a voting body, an execution body, and a communications body, while the Arbitrum Foundation retained responsibility for fund movement and custody. That may improve execution speed. It also concentrates operational power into a smaller and more legible set of actors.

Start with a control map, not a target APY

A treasury strategy should begin with a written control map that names every party that can change a financially material parameter. For a token project, that list usually includes the tokenholder vote, the treasury multisig, any legal wrapper that can open bank or brokerage accounts, and any external manager that can deploy assets within a mandate. If that map is missing, the treasury is not decentralized. It is merely undocumented.

The dangerous parameters are usually not the obvious ones. Asset allocation bands matter, but signer rotation, threshold changes, emergency withdrawal rights, venue whitelists, and mandate revocation rights matter more. Safe’s own documentation makes clear that owner sets and thresholds can be changed. Aera’s treasury vault design makes the same point from another angle: the vault owner can execute arbitrary actions, deposit, and withdraw liquid assets, while guardians operate inside an onchain constraint system and a whitelisted set of protocols. Those are power boundaries, not implementation details.

Arbitrum’s 2024 strategic treasury proposal is a useful template for writing control boundaries plainly. It said the DAO would retain full ownership of assets, the strategic group would not have withdrawal rights to the Safe, role-based access controls would be pre-approved, and the DAO could shut the structure down through governance. That is the right level of specificity. “Managed by the DAO” is not.

Size the treasury against liabilities, not against FDV

The correct denominator for treasury planning is liabilities, not market cap. If payroll, grants, legal bills, market makers, and vendors are paid in dollars or dollar-like terms, the treasury has dollar liabilities even if the balance sheet is mostly native tokens. Arbitrum’s treasury management proposal described this problem directly: several DAO-funded programs and service providers had dollar-denominated contracts, while the DAO did not always have enough ARB at then-current prices to meet the agreed rate. That is a treasury mismatch, not a market problem.

ENS and Uniswap both moved toward explicit runway segmentation. On November 29, 2022, ENS governance said the DAO would keep $16 million in USDC in its main wallet and timelock as roughly two years of runway. ENS later formalized stricter endowment guidance through its Investment Policy Statement, including a more conservative 40% stablecoin allocation and a minimum stablecoin allocation of at least three years of DAO operating expenses in stablecoin or stablecoin-neutral positions.

Uniswap Foundation used a similar liability-first logic. Its October 5, 2023 funding proposal asked for $46.2 million to cover two years of operating and grants runway with a 10% buffer for price risk, required governance approval for grants larger than $2 million, and described a treasury diversification policy that kept six months of operating runway in cash and six months of grants funding in an FDIC-insured bank account while the rest could be placed in low-risk yield-bearing assets. The same discipline belongs in stress testing treasury assumptions.

By September 30, 2025, Uniswap Foundation reported $54.4 million in USD and stables on hand plus 15.3 million UNI, with expected runway through January 2027. The structure is the point. Stable operating liquidity and native-token strategic exposure were held as separate treasury functions, not blended into one pool and called diversification.

Separate operating liquidity from strategic reserves and deployment capital

The worst treasury design keeps everything in the native token and pretends time will solve it. Native-token concentration is political comfort dressed up as conviction. It keeps governance power concentrated in the same constituency that benefits from not selling, but it forces the organization to liquidate into weakness when liabilities arrive. A treasury policy should make that trade-off explicit instead of hiding it inside vague language about long-term alignment.

There is now a large enough onchain treasury product set to separate liquidity needs from strategic holdings. RWA.xyz reported tokenized U.S. Treasuries totaling $10.71 billion across 64 products as of February 14, 2026. That does not remove risk. It changes the risk stack from crypto beta toward issuer, structure, redemption, and access risk. But it does mean projects can hold a meaningful operating reserve without leaving the digital asset ecosystem entirely.

Arbitrum’s STEP framework shows the logic clearly. STEP 2.0 authorized another 35 million ARB to a multisig to diversify treasury exposure into real-world assets that were intended to be stable in value, liquid in conversion, and yield-generating with returns uncorrelated to crypto markets. That is a treasury function with two goals at once: reduce treasury volatility and support a strategic sector inside the ecosystem. Those goals can coexist, but they should never be confused. Strategic sector support is not the same thing as treasury safety.

A practical rule is simple. Operating liquidity should not depend on the next governance token rally. Strategic reserves can. Growth deployments may. When a project mixes those mandates inside one wallet with one approval path, the strongest political faction usually captures the treasury narrative. That is exactly when the treasury stops being a balance-sheet tool and becomes a legitimacy prop.

Build an execution stack that can be audited and recalled

A treasury mandate is only real if the execution stack enforces it. Safe provides multisig thresholds and owner management. OpenZeppelin timelocks can impose a delay before privileged actions go live. Aera vaults let owners define whitelisted protocols and constrain guardians onchain. Used together, those primitives let a project separate policy from execution: governance sets the allowed range, operators act inside it, and users get time to react before privileged changes settle.

The key design choice is whether managers hold withdrawal authority. Arbitrum’s 2024 strategic treasury proposal said the management group would execute pre-approved strategies but would not have withdrawal rights to the Safe, and that the DAO could recall or shut down the structure through governance. That is materially safer than outsourcing full custody. It is also slower. That trade-off is healthy. Operational flexibility should be purchased consciously, not by accident.

The strongest treasury setups publish five operational controls in advance.

  1. Public signer list and threshold.
  2. Timelocked changes for signer rotation, manager replacement, and whitelist expansion.
  3. Predefined allowable venues and instruments.
  4. Emergency recall path with named authority and mandatory forum disclosure.
  5. Independent reporting that lets tokenholders verify positions, not just trust summaries.

If a project cannot publish those controls, it does not have a treasury strategy. It has a treasury operator.

Delegate narrowly, and keep constitutional powers broad

Most token projects need delegated treasury execution. Very few should delegate constitutional treasury powers. The clean line is this: managers and committees can rebalance inside pre-approved ranges, but tokenholders should retain authority over new strategy types, custody changes, mandate expansions, and changes to the people who control the wallet.

Uniswap Foundation offers one workable example of bounded delegation. The Foundation could administer grants and operations, but grants larger than $2 million still required governance approval. That is a real boundary. It tells the market which spending remains political and which spending is operational.

Arbitrum’s newer treasury architecture uses a different pattern. The 2025 consolidation proposal gave the Oversight and Transparency body approval power over allocations, required a 3/5 consensus for deployment decisions, allowed emergency withdrawals from prior allocations, and kept a tokenholder clawback path through Snapshot votes with a 3% votable-supply threshold. The mechanism is more centralized in day-to-day execution than naive DAO rhetoric suggests, but it is also more explicit about how power can be reversed. That is a better form of centralization than pretending it does not exist.

Report the treasury as a power system, not just a portfolio

Treasury reporting should show more than balances, APY, and PnL. Arbitrum’s strategic treasury proposal called for monthly reports and real-time dashboards, and ENS’s IPS was designed to set responsibilities, performance evaluation standards, and annual review. Those are good foundations, but the missing piece in many DAO reports is governance telemetry: who changed what, under which authority, and how much delegated discretion remains unused.

A useful monthly treasury report for a token project should disclose current runway by liability currency, concentration by asset and counterparty, unrealized governance exposure from unvested token commitments, all mandate changes since the prior report, and every emergency or out-of-band action. Without that layer, tokenholders can see performance but not power. For governance, power is the risk variable.

That is also where treasury strategy meets token economy design. Unlock schedules, incentive budgets, buyback programs, liquidity support, grants, and runway policy all compete for the same balance sheet.
